Subject: [PATCH] ahci: only try to use multi-MSI mode if there is more than 1 port
Date: Tue, 18 Oct 2016 09:00:52 +0200 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1476774052-12662-1-git-send-email-hch@lst.de> (raw)
We should only try to allocate multiple MSI or MSI-X vectors if the device
actually has multiple ports. Otherwise pci_alloc_irq_vectors will return
a single vector due to n_ports = 1, in which case we shouldn't set the
AHCI_HFLAG_MULTI_MSI flag.
